Output f75b74159349cef1ea26e16b1a6f29e099ec620a95a4b5aa374cd9da16c9ec94:1

value
54333104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 064ca8e4261549cb0a00408ffbc8fb8a8caba79c OP_EQUAL
address
M8UU7zXczMSPQLZdY976YUb8FRKSoKLLWY
transaction
f75b74159349cef1ea26e16b1a6f29e099ec620a95a4b5aa374cd9da16c9ec94
spent
true